Abstract :
A portable system for determination of biochemical parameters by optic reflection is described in this paper. This system worked in visible spectral range of 400~700 nm and the spectrum resolution was 10 nm. The detected parameter´s concentration is calculated mathematically according to the calibration equation established between the index of reflection and the reference concentration. Combined with the biosensors developed by our group, the system was used to determine Hemoglobin (HB) and Alanine Aminotransferase (ALT), which were two preferred biochemical parameters for the evaluation in blood dedication. The detection of HB and ALT were experimentalized in National Center for Clinical Laboratories (NCCL) of China and Red Cross Blood Center of Beijing, China respectively. And the detected results correlated well with that obtained by the large equipments employed by the two centers mentioned above. Compared to large equipments used in traditional method, this system is portable, rapid to get results and can be operated simply
